Abstract

The present invention provides a kind of display device of curvature-adjustable, including display module and curvature adjustment portion;The display module includes the first support of flexible back plate with the back two sides for being symmetricly set on the flexible back plate, and first support is fixedly connected with the flexible back plate;The curvature adjustment portion includes the regulating part made of magnetostriction alloy, and the regulating part is located between two first supports and the end of the regulating part is touched with corresponding first support, is wound with conductive coil on the regulating part.The utility model has the advantages that passing through the opening and closing and size that adjust the electric current on conductive coil, to adjust the magnetic force size in the magnetic field of conductive coil generation, so as to adjust the flexible size of size of regulating part, achieve the purpose that the curved surface curvature for adjusting display module, to adapt to different customer demands.

Embodiment one:
A kind of display device of curvature-adjustable, as depicted in figs. 1 and 2, the display device of the curvature-adjustable include display Mould group 10 and curvature adjustment portion 20.
Wherein, the display module 10 includes flexible back plate 11 and the back two sides for being symmetricly set on the flexible back plate 11 The first support 12, first support 12 is fixedly connected with the flexible back plate 11;The curvature adjustment portion 20 includes by magnetic Regulating part 21 made of flexible alloy is caused, the regulating part 21 is located between two first supports 12 and the regulating part 21 End touched with corresponding first support 12.
Wherein, the promising regulating part 21 is wound on the regulating part 21, and the conductive coil 22 in magnetic field is provided.
When by magnetic fields, the size of magnetostriction alloy can change magnetostriction alloy, conductive coil 22 Magnetic field is generated after energization, regulating part 21 issues raw length direction variable elongation in magnetic fields, the first support 12 is jacked up, to make Entire display module 10 is bent, and after conductive coil 22 powers off, display module 10 is restored to flat state;By adjusting conductive coil Size of current on 22, to adjust the magnetic force size in the magnetic field of the generation of conductive coil 22, the size so as to adjust regulating part 21 is stretched Contracting size achievees the purpose that the curved surface curvature for adjusting display module 10, to adapt to different customer demands.
It should be noted that in actual implementation, the number of turns of the conductive coil 22 is according to the length of the regulating part 21 It is selected, the length of regulating part 21 is longer, and the number of turns of conductive coil 22 is more;After conductive coil 22 is powered, the regulating part 21 length variation is 0.1%~0.4%.
It should be noted that the magnetostriction alloy is iron-nickel alloy, ferroaluminium or rare earth ferroalloy.
Specifically, the second support 13 being fixedly connected with flexible back plate 11 is provided between two first supports 12, And second support 13 is located at the center of the flexible back plate 11, the regulating part 21 runs through second support 13.
The regulating part 21 is constrained by the second support 13, so that regulating part 21 be made to extend by direction initialization Variation jacks up the first support 12 convenient for regulating part 21, so that display module 10 be made to generate bending.
Further, second support 13 is located at the center of the flexible back plate 11.
Further, the regulating part 21 is slidably connected with second support 13 along its length.
Second support 13 described in when preventing the regulating part 21 from telescopic variation occurring along its length is to regulating part 21 Length variation causes to hinder, while preventing 11 center position of flexible back plate from generating stress concentration causes display module 10 to be damaged.
It should be noted that first support 12 and second support 13 can pass through the side such as welding, bonding or screw Formula is fixedly connected with flexible back plate 11, numerous to list herein.
As shown in figure 3, first support 12 is provided with close to the side of the regulating part 21 for the regulating part 21 The groove 121 of end insertion.
By the way that groove 121 is inserted into the end of regulating part 21, to be limited to the end of regulating part 21, to reach Regulating part 21 occurs to make flexible panel by the curved purpose of direction initialization when elongation along its length.
It should be noted that the regulating part 21 be it is rod-shaped, the shapes and sizes of the cross section of the groove 121 with it is described The shapes and sizes of the cross section of regulating part 21 are adapted.
The shape of the cross section of the regulating part 21 is round, rectangular or square.
